Aesthetic Medicine Definition  

Aesthetic medicine refers to various specialties related to the process of modifying the physical appearance of a patient. Also referred to as non-surgical cosmetic treatments, aesthetic medicine can help enhance a person’s facial and body appearance. Specialists have carried out approximately 8 million cosmetic procedures since 2009.  

Types of aesthetic treatments 

Here is an outline of different types of aesthetic treatment:  

Laser treatments- The painless removal of hair from different parts of the body. Laser treatment can also remedy conditions such as acne, pigmentation marks, rough dull skin and enlarged pores.  

Micro needling- This is also known as skin needling and is a cosmetic procedure which involves puncturing the skin repeatedly with tiny, sterile needles. It is used to treat skin problems such as acne and scarring. 

Anti-wrinkle treatment- This aesthetic procedure involves reducing, masking or preventing signs of skin aging. Among the common signs of an aging skin include laxity, wrinkles and photoaging (redness, brown discoloration, yellowing, abnormal growths and poor texture).  

Dermal fillers- This is an effective anti-aging method. It restores lost volume in order to soften the creases and enhance facial contour. In a short period of time it produces natural looking results. 

Medical-grade skincare also known as cosmeceutical skincare. They are used in specific medical conditions and needs. They offer both medical and cosmetic benefits. They have positive effects on the skin. 

Skin resurfacing treatment is the most effective way to reduce signs of aging, correct dark spots and fade scarring.
